Champions Györ face RK Krim Mercator when Women’s EHF Champions League throws off

In 74 days the Women’s EHF Champions League Group Matches of the 2018/19 throw off and fans can start preparing for some great clashes already in the early stages of the competition.

The playing schedule, which has been released by the European Handball Federation, sees CSM Bucuresti, the 2016 winners and three-time participants of the Women’s EHF FINAL4, facing FTC Rail-Cargo Hungaria on the first matchday in group D, scheduled for 5 to 7 October 2018.

Hungarian side FTC have reached the quarter-finals in all of the past three seasons, and this clash is arguably the biggest of all at the competition’s start. In the second match, Vipers Kristiansand from Norway face the winners of qualification tournament no.1 (played on 8/9 September).

However, defending champions Györi Audi ETO KC must not take things too easy in group C either, as they face RK Krim Mercator at the beginning of October. The Slovenian team has been a regular in the main round in the past decade and even won the EHF Champions League in 2001 and 2003.

Last season, Györ dominated both main round encounters between the two teams, winning 32:21 and 34:25.

German champions Thüringer HC and the winning team of qualification tournament no.2 are the two remaining teams in group C.

In group B, last season’s Women’s EHF FINAL4 participants Rostov-Don play their first match against IK Sävehof, while Danish team Kobenhavn Handball face Brest Bretagne Handball.

In group A, the 2015 champions, Montenegrin side Buducnost, open their EHF Champions League season against debutants Odense HC, the second Danish side in the competition. Metz Handball and Larvik HK complete this very balanced group.
